Verdict
There can be no doubting the ease in which DISCOVERIE has completed a course and distance double in the last few weeks and a 7lb penalty hardly looks enough to prevent a hat-trick. Teescomponents Max showed his first sign of potential on his latest start at Uttoxeter but that was over hurdles back in July on very quick going. Teachmetobouggie wears a visor for the first time and he's another making his chasing debut as is the five-year-old Pretty Mobile. The latter is Paul Webber's only runner-at the meeting and though she showed little over timber her pedigree is all about jumping the bigger obstacles.
